摘要
The present invention provides a tunnel excavation method for kerfing a portion of an outer surface of a tunnel to reduce blasting vibration. The tunnel excavation method for kerfing a portion of an outer surface of a tunnel to reduce blasting vibration kerfs a portion of an outer surface of an excavated tunnel, and bores a pre-large hole in the excavated tunnel to secure a free surface to perform an internal blast. Partial kerfing of the outer surface of an excavated tunnel is carried out by linear kerfing to a prescribed angle towards a protective building using a method such as a wire saw or a water jet to reduce blasting vibration. Moreover, the wire saw or the water jet is used for precise excavation; and noise, vibration, and dust produced when excavating the tunnel are reduced to excavate the tunnel in an environmentally friendly and safe manner.
